Abstract

This article offers a reflection on the small-scale representations of scenes created in nunneries, their visual and symbolic sources, as well as identifying the data they contain, for they bear witness to a lifestyle now lost. They are also indicative of the vision that the nuns had of their own space. The reasons and purposes of these creations are analyzed, in addition to arguing for the need to catalogue these works, overlooked by scholars in the past, because works of this type in cloisters, museums, and private Spanish collections are a potentially valuable source of information about cloistered life.
